Шахматный движок Leela
Что такое LC0 в шахматах?
Итак, что такое LC0 в шахматах?
Короче говоря, LC0 — это движок на основе нейронной сети, который получает больше знаний о шахматах, играя сам с собой снова и снова. Это может звучать просто, но это имеет значение.
Старые движки были построены скорее как системы с правилами. Они присваивают ценность материалу, безопасности короля, пешечной структуре — таким вещам. LC0 тоже «понимает» эти идеи, но он не учился им по фиксированному своду правил. Он усвоил их через опыт.
Именно поэтому движок иногда может стремиться к позициям, которые не выглядят выигрышными сразу. Он распознаёт паттерны, видя их снова и снова, а не просто рассчитывая.
Особенности Leela Chess
Если вы действительно смотрите партии, а не просто читаете об особенностях Leela Chess, различия становятся яснее.
Он не торопится.
Возможно, это самый простой способ описать его.
Некоторые вещи обычно бросаются в глаза:
- он делает ходы, которые медленно улучшают позицию, а не форсируют события
- ему комфортно жертвовать материал, если это даёт долгосрочный контроль
- он избегает ненужных осложнений, если нет чёткой причины
- он часто сохраняет напряжение вместо того, чтобы разрешить его немедленно
По сравнению с традиционными движками, LCZero Chess в этом смысле кажется менее механическим. Не слабее — просто другой подход.
История Leela Chess Zero
История Leela Chess Zero довольно тесно связана с AlphaZero.
Когда AlphaZero показал, что нейронная сеть может достичь силы топ-уровня, обучаясь сама, люди захотели открытую версию этой идеи. Что-то, куда каждый мог бы внести вклад.
Так появился Leela Chess Zero.
Вместо того чтобы разрабатываться за закрытыми дверями, он рос шаг за шагом. Люди предоставляли вычислительную мощность, генерировались партии, сеть улучшалась, и со временем она достигла конкурентной силы.
Не было одного «прорывного момента». Всё было более постепенно.
Достижения LC0 Chess
Глядя на достижения LC0 Chess, да — он стал одним из сильнейших движков.
Но это не та часть, которую большинство игроков запоминает.
Что бросается в глаза, так это то, как он справлялся с партиями против таких движков, как Stockfish. Результаты, конечно, имели значение, но разницу в стиле было трудно игнорировать.
Stockfish рассчитывал чрезвычайно глубокие, очень конкретные варианты.
LCZero Chess, с другой стороны, иногда делал ходы, которые не делали ничего немедленного. Ни шаха, ни взятия — просто небольшое улучшение. А затем, через несколько ходов, позиция вдруг становилась трудной.
Этот паттерн проявляется снова и снова.
Матчи Leela Chess
Если вы просмотрите матчи Leela Chess, особенно длинные, вы заметите кое-что необычное.
Преимущество не всегда проявляется сразу.
Есть партии, где шахматный движок Leela рано жертвует пешку, и ничего очевидного не происходит. Ни прямой атаки. Ни немедленного продолжения. Просто… немного лучшая позиция.
Затем медленно:
- фигуры ограничиваются
- поля становятся труднодоступными
- взаимодействие нарушается
И к тому времени, когда это становится заметно, исправить это уже слишком поздно.
Отчасти поэтому люди изучают партии LCZero Chess. Не только чтобы увидеть, кто выиграл, но и чтобы понять, что происходило до того как это стало очевидным.
Другой взгляд на позиции
Для обычных игроков LC0 Chess — это не просто ещё один инструмент анализа.
Он меняет вопросы, которые вы задаёте.
Вместо: «какой здесь лучший ход?»
Становится больше похоже на:
- что на самом деле важно в этой позиции
- какие фигуры ничего не делают
- что будет, если я сейчас ничего не форсирую
Шахматный движок Leela склонен выделять такие идеи, даже если он не объясняет их напрямую.
Заключение
Заключение не в том, что Leela Chess Zero просто силён.
Это уже ожидаемо.
Что выделяет его, так это то, как он подходит к игре. Он не полагается исключительно на расчёт в традиционном смысле. Он строит понимание со временем, и это проявляется в ходах, которые он делает.
Называете ли вы его LCZero Chess, LC0 Chess или шахматным движком Leela, эффект тот же, и он позволяет людям взглянуть на шахматные компьютеры совсем иначе. Увидев его в нескольких партиях, трудно забыть это и ту разницу, которую он вносит.